Web27 mrt. 2024 · A yarn winder isn’t fully useful without that wooden tool at the back, beside the skeins of yarn in the photo. It’s called a swift. It does 2 important things: it holds the skein in its scissor-like ”arms”, keeping the skein from dropping to the table in a gnarled mess, and it allows for the smooth transfer of yarn to the yarn winder.

Web26 jul. 2024 · In this article, we’ll show you 4 nifty ways you can wind a yarn ball by hand. Method 1 Using the Finger Wrap Technique 1 Pinch the yarn between your thumb and forefinger. Hold the string just above the end, leaving about 1 inch (2.5 cm) of excess. The longer end of the yarn can be placed in a bowl or on a table while you wind. [1]
